Design In is a strategic approach to product development and manufacturing where design considerations are integrated from the earliest stages of planning through to final production. This comprehensive methodology emphasizes the importance of incorporating design principles, aesthetic considerations, and functional requirements at the inception of a project, rather than treating design as a superficial overlay added near completion. The process involves close collaboration between designers, engineers, manufacturers, and other stakeholders to ensure that design elements are inherently woven into every aspect of product development. This approach gained prominence in the mid-20th century as industries recognized that early design integration could significantly reduce costs, improve product quality, and enhance market success. Design In philosophy encompasses various aspects including material selection, manufacturing processes, assembly methods, and sustainability considerations, all of which are considered simultaneously rather than sequentially. This integrated approach often results in more innovative solutions, as design challenges are addressed proactively rather than reactively. The methodology has become increasingly important in contemporary product development, particularly as sustainability and circular economy principles demand more thoughtful consideration of product lifecycle impacts from the outset. The practice requires extensive knowledge of materials, manufacturing processes, and market requirements, combined with creative problem-solving skills and an understanding of user needs. In modern industrial contexts, Design In often incorporates digital tools and simulation technologies to validate design decisions before physical prototyping, enabling more efficient and effective product development cycles.
